Call for SMEs to support innovation in manufacturing

The MAGICIAN project invites startups and SMEs developing next-generation solutions in robotics, AI, machine learning, computer vision, sensor technologies, and smart manufacturing to submit their proposals on integrating new functionalities within the MAGICIAN robotic solutions, namely the Sensing Robot (SR) for defect detection, and the Cleaning Robot (CR) for defect removal. Open Call applications are expected to demonstrate the use of advanced technologies such as AI and sensor systems to improve the efficiency of production processes in manufacturing.

Specifically, the call focuses on the integration of new functionalities within the MAGICIAN project solutions through close collaboration with the MAGICIAN partners. The aim is to enhance the capabilities of the SR (Sensing Robot) and CR (Cleaning Robot) through advanced technologies such as:

  • improved defect detection algorithms,
  • more efficient rework techniques, or
  • complementary AI modules that optimize their performance in real-time production environments.

Funded projects must provide a solution by focusing on a single module, namely either F1 Perception or F2 Human-Robot Collaboration. The Open Call will fund up to 5 SMEs/start-ups.

Funding:

Each proposal will have a maximum budget of 200k€. Eligible costs will follow the same rules of Horizon Europe (HE) as per the HE AMGA, and will include personnel, equipment depreciation (for purchase) or renting (i.e. for robots), other and indirect costs.

The deadline to submit applications is set to 2 May 2025.
